She was born Oct. 7, 1913, in the Key West community east of Lebo, the daughter of Clarence C. and Winnie Williams Taylor. She attended schools in the Strawn and Lebo communities. She lived in Reading from 1934 until 1982 when she moved to Emporia. She was employed by the Reading School lunch program from 1951 to 1959.
She was a member of the United Methodist Church in Reading and provided homegrown flowers for church events for many years. She was a member of Orphah Chapter No. 140 of Order of Eastern Star and the Social Club, both in Reading.
She married William H. VerBrugge II on April 26, 1935. He died March 25, 1947. She married Frank Schlageter on April 15, 1956. He died Sept. 21, 1969. A daughter, Ella Dean VerBrugge, died Dec. 7, 1935.
